Recent advances in communication technologies especially in wireless network are facilitating the emergency of new classes of network organization. Mobile Ad hoc Network (MANET) is one of the most important. It is a self-organizing network which composed by mobile nodes, using wireless transmission without the supports of stationary infrastructure and centralized administration. It's easy to deploy, but many potential problems exist, for example, resources are strictly limited, topology is dynamic, the performance and security goals are not satisfied and so on. For these reasons, many researches focus on its protocol design. Due to its dynamic property, automatic service discovery is obviously crucial for MANET, and become an indispensable component in protocol stack of MANET. This thesis focuses on the study of light weight service discovery protocol and its mechanisms for MANET.In fact, route discovery protocol and service discovery protocol all belongs to resource location protocol. Similar mechanisms exist in these two protocols. Traditional solutions don't pay attention to this fact. As a result, the mechanisms are executed repeatedly, redundant data are produced and the performance slows down. In order to solve this problem, we propose a ZRP-based service discovery protocol– CZRP, which blend seamlessly with route discovery protocol. In CZRP's zone, active route and service discovery is adopted, otherwise, reactive route and service discovery is adopted. Since the closely relationship between the route protocol and the service discovery protocol, these mechanisms lead to network delay reduced and performance improved. Especially no additional cost exists if services have started before the network topology is formed, except the size of control packets grows. Since MANET is very susceptible to security threats, we propose an enhanced protocol SCZRP based on CZRP, which using symmetric encryption technology to support secure authentication. Service authentication process is started when service discovery request is begin; the process is completed when the service is really used.Through the process, service requesters and providers can be authenticated and services can be used credibly and securely. Besides these, common nodes can also be authenticated by providing a secure authentication service in our mechanism.Quantitative analysis and simulation result also show that it's feasible and effective to implement service discovery protocol based on existed route protocols using cross-layer design methodology.
